PRPH2

Gene
PRPH2
Protein
Peripherin-2
Organism
Gallus gallus
Length
354 amino acids
Function
May function as an adhesion molecule involved in stabilization and compaction of outer segment disks or in the maintenance of the curvature of the rim. It is essential for disk morphogenesis (By similarity).
Similarity
Belongs to the PRPH2/ROM1 family.
Mass
40.208 kDa
